  • One you should treasure, but not as a possession,
    Who needs to be loved, not treated with aggression.
    Her value is more than all the world’s treasures,
    Not just the sum of scale’s unit measures.
    She should always be built up, not torn down,
    By all the words you speak, when she is around.
    She needs to be hugged and not pushed away,
    Especially when you are both having a really bad day.
    Words spoken to her in haste and anger
    Can place her fragile heart in danger.
    She should be admired for her boundless love,
    And looked upon as a true gift from Above.
    Not used as a target for all your frustration,
    But held close and kissed with loving admiration.
    You should always appreciate her commitment to you,
    And not take for granted what she’s given up for you!
    Kiss her and love her all that you possibly can,
    And don’t be embarrassed to be seen holding her hand.
    Treasure each day as if it were the last,
    And at the end of your life you won’t be regretting your past.

  • I love you so deeply,
    I love you so much,
    I love the sound of your voice
    And the way that we touch.
    I love your warm smile
    And your kind, thoughtful way,
    The joy that you bring
    To my life every day.
    I love you today
    As I have from the start,
    And I’ll love you forever
    With all of my heart.

  • Living, I had no might
    To make you hear,
    Now, in the inmost night,
    I am so near
    No whisper, falling light,
    Divides us, dear.
    Living, I had no claim
    On your great hours.
    Now the thin candle-flame,
    The closing flowers,
    Wed summer with my name, —
    And these are ours.
    Your shadow on the dust,
    Strength, and a cry,
    Delight, despair, mistrust, —
    All these am I.
    Dawn, and the far hills thrust
    To a far sky.
    Living, I had no skill
    To stay your tread,
    Now all that was my will
    Silence has said.
    We are one for good and ill
    Since I am dead.
